Occurrence of sleep disorders in the families of narcoleptic patients.

Abstract:

:First-degree relatives of narcoleptic subjects (probands) may have sleep pathology related to the transmission of the disorder through their family members. The authors examined four groups: probands (n = 96), first-degree relative (n = 337), environmental reference (n = 85), and general population (n = 6,694) groups. Compared with the general population, family members have a 75-fold increased risk for narcolepsy. They are also at greater risk for insufficient sleep syndrome (odds ratio [OR] 6.1), nocturnal eating (OR 5.7), and adjustment sleep disorder (OR 3.1).

  • The "sinister" Tolosa-Hunt syndrome.

    abstract::Four patients with presumed Tolosa-Hunt syndrome ultimately proved to have a parasellar tumor. All four had manifestations of a cavernous sinus syndrome, normal radiologic and medical investigations, and response to steroid therapy. The Tolosa-Hunt syndrome is a diagnosis of exclusion; many other lesions can simulate ...

  • Imipramine-mediated interference with levodopa absorption from the gastrointestinal tract in man.

    abstract::The effect of imipramine on the absorption of a single dose of levodopa was studied in male volunteers. By delaying gastric emptying and retarding delivery to intestinal absorptive sites, imipramine interfered with the absorption of levodopa. This action caused by the anticholinergic effect of imipramine. The retardat...
